Acting Attorney General Todd Blanche defended Tuesday the Justice Department’s decision to open a $1.8 billion “anti-weaponization” fund to help Jan. 6 rioters and other allies of President Donald Trump, as he testified before Congress for the first time since replacing former Attorney General Pam Bondi.
